The French and Indian War changed the political face of America. The French, who had once controlled vast stretches of North America, were now limited to two small islands near Newfoundland. The British, the winners of the conflict, found themselves in possession of half of America and all of what would be Canada. Spanish controlled lands included New Orleans and lands west of the Mississippi River.
